Default Accelero Xtreme 9800 For an XFX 9800 GT

So yeah, I ordered the Accelero Xtreme 9800, under the impression that it fit all 9800 GT card ( Says so on the site I ordered it from, Coolerguys.com ).

But now, I just recieved it, and oh crap is it big, doesn't seem like it's gonna fit and I don't wanna try it on and have it not fit, which would ruin my warranty, anyone knows about it?

Edit : I also don't care if I need to modifiy it or anything to make it fit, I just need to know if it's possible to MAKE it fit

In order for us to help you better, please fill in your system specs in your User CP. With that information, plus a little more about the exact 9800GT you have (i.e. your model #, perhaps even a picture, if that's possible), we can be of more assistance to you.

If I knew exactly which card you have, I could tell you if you have a reference design. But my first instinct is that if yours is an XFX, then it's reference, and there's not reason why the cooler shouldn't mount on properly without having to do any modifications.

EDIT: Also, XFX does not void your warranty if you change the cooler, trust me. Try it out, you'll be surprised how simple it is to swap out. Just be sure to clean all the surfaces and apply some fresh TIM.

The accelero cooler you provided a picture of in your OP looked like the one for the 4870x2's or the GTX 280 or something. I'm not sure what happened there.

See the muderMod link in my sig and go to post 2 (contents table) and click the one for my graphics cards.

I have two Thermalright T-Rad2's on my 8800GT's (will definitely fit on your 9800). They're pretty pricey (about $55 each), but I absolutely love mine.

Otherwise people seem to like the Thermaltake DuoOrbs alot.

I personally think these Scythe Musashis look pretty effective (same fans I'm using on my T-Rads).
